Focus

First and foremost, outsourcing your logistics provides you with the opportunity to focus.  As an entrepreneur, it’s common to juggle multiple tasks simultaneously, such as sales, marketing, customer service, and administration. Not to mention the need for future planning and growth strategies.

The logistics process is often something that is done ‘on the side.’ While it may not be a problem with a few orders, as volumes grow, logistics becomes a time-consuming task. If you don’t have enough staff to handle this workload, it can affect both the quality of logistics and customer service. By outsourcing logistics, you ensure that the right focus is placed on both aspects.

Specialty

Logistics is a specialized field that requires a lot of specific knowledge to guide all things in the right direction. This includes various laws and regulations, as well as knowing how to prepare a pallet for transportation. A logistics partner is aware of the critical points and the requirements that need to be met. Additionally, a logistics partner possesses the necessary technology and software to execute logistics correctly and efficiently, such as a warehouse management system and IT integrations for data exchange. If your orders require extra handling or if you want to apply your branding, many logistics partners can accommodate these requests without any issues!

Cost savings

Yes, outsourcing logistics comes with a cost. However, outsourcing your logistics can also lead to cost savings. Logistics service providers, due to their large volumes, can often negotiate favorable agreements with shipping partners and suppliers of packaging materials. When you entrust your logistics to them, you can also benefit from these competitive rates.

If you currently manage the logistics of your orders in-house, you are likely tied to fixed expenses such as warehouse rent and the salaries of warehouse staff, regardless of the amount of stored products or placed orders. With a logistics partner, you only pay for the space you actually use and the orders that are placed. No fixed overhead costs, therefore.

Flexibility

It would be a relief if a warehouse could adjust to the space you need, but unfortunately, that’s not the case. However, a logistics partner can provide you with the flexibility to scale up and down more easily. This is especially handy when you work with seasonal products or during busy times like the holiday season. If you store goods in your own warehouse but can’t accommodate the pallets during a peak period, you can choose to store the extra goods with a logistics partner during these times. If it works well, you can even decide to entrust all your logistics to an external partner, allowing you to serve your customers from a single inventory during peak periods

Efficiency

Thanks to their knowledge and experience, your logistics partner can provide advice and assistance in optimizing and streamlining your logistics process. If you have outsourced transportation to a partner who can also handle the logistics, the synergy between the two can be quite powerful. The entire logistics handling of your orders, from storage to delivery to the customer, can be seamlessly coordinated. This results in a fast and efficient process

Cons

One drawback of outsourcing logistics can be the feeling of losing visibility over your inventory. When you’re no longer physically present in the warehouse on a daily basis, you have less direct oversight of the products on the shelves, and you can’t handle urgent orders on the spot. Therefore, you must trust your logistics partner. Fortunately, this can be addressed with good warehouse software and a flexible service provider. Additionally, implementing your logistics processes with a logistics service provider requires time and effort to ensure that all processes are well set up and systems are integrated.

To avoid these drawbacks, it’s crucial to find a partner that aligns with your vision and processes.
